Summary:After Gilmore's death, David Wallis Reeves (1838-1900), attempted to continue the band under Gilmore's name. While Reeves was, by all accounts, a fine musician, the competition from the newly formed Sousa Band proved to be too much for the ensemble, and it soon failed.
